【基于api的查询系统源码】【hexfrvr 源码】【mokoid 源码】eos共识源码_eos共识机制

时间:2024-12-22 22:39:15 来源:正义传说资源码 编辑:动态代理平台源码

1.重建中的共共识EOS:“初代以太坊杀手”要回来了?
2.EOS超级节点竞选到底是什么?有什么用?
3.必看ETH低风险套利的一种方法
4.eos和以太坊的区别
5.什么是POW、POS、识源DPOS、机制POR

eos共识源码_eos共识机制

重建中的共共识EOS:“初代以太坊杀手”要回来了?

       EOS,曾被认为在Layer 1领域具有巨大潜力的识源区块链之一。在发布初期,机制基于api的查询系统源码EOS是共共识市值排名前五的加密货币。然而,识源EOS未能达到预期,机制社区将责任归咎于创始团队的共共识开发和投资不足。在年,识源EOS社区开始转变方向,机制首先与创始团队拉开距离,共共识并在年冻结了创始团队的识源代币释放合约。随后,机制在年,社区分叉开源代码库,ENF工作组推动生态系统和协议改进,包括最近的IBC实现。尽管EOS面临时间上的损失,但ENF计划通过共识机制升级、EVM解决方案和新战略吸引新用户。

       开源EOSIO区块链协议由Block.one创立,由Brendan Blumer和Dan Larimer领导。B1在以太坊上进行了为期一年的首次代币发行,并筹集了亿美元,创下了历史上最大的纪录。然而,SEC指控B1进行了未经注册的证券发行,并同意支付万美元的民事罚款。尽管如此,B1仍然在年中发布了EOSIO代码库,并在一周后启动了EOS网络。上线后,B1逐渐停止了对核心EOSIO协议的升级和维护,将资源转移到EOS之外的项目。

       在B1的主导下,EOS社区越来越沮丧,认识到需要采取行动防止EOSIO代码库和生态系统衰退。年8月,非营利性EOS网络基金会(ENF)由EOS区块生产者和节点基础设施公司EOS Nation前首席执行官Yves La Rose创立。在区块生产者资金支持下,ENF对EOS技术和生态系统进行审查,确定改进领域并提出解决方案。年月,社区通过冻结B1的EOS代币释放合约的提案,标志着正式将EOS与B1分离并将所有权归还社区的关键步骤。年9月,社区所有权的努力最终导致从EOSIO代码库到新的Antelope代码库的硬分叉。

       技术方面,EOS基于拜占庭容错(BFT)区块链,采用委托权益证明(DPoS)的权益证明变体。用户通过将代币委托给验证者(区块生产者或BP)来参与区块生产和验证。与一些其他PoS系统不同,委托人不会将代币抵押给特定的BP。相反,hexfrvr 源码他们通常将代币抵押给系统,然后投票选出最多个BP。根据投票排名,前名被称为“活跃BP”,参与每轮共识。共识轮持续秒,由个区块组成。BP通过1%的网络通胀获得区块奖励,这包括网络通胀的1%中的一部分。

       智能合约编程语言方面,EOS的智能合约用C++编写,但正在开发更多使用Rust、Go和AssemblyScript的SDK。开发团队也在构建一个支持流行的Web3语言Solidity的EVM解决方案。资源模型方面,EOS将资源合并到一个gas费用中,分为带宽NET和CPU。带宽NET和CPU共同承担网络带宽成本。最初,NET和CPU是可再生资源,用户根据持有EOS份额按比例保留。资源交易所(REX)允许用户抵押EOS并将其多余的带宽资源借给借款人,以获得REX代币。此外,EOS还引入了PowerUp资源模型来改善资源管理。

       状态存储方面,用户直接支付与在账户中存储数据相关的费用,包括任何可替代代币、NFT、NFT列表等。RAM是一种有限资源,用户可以买卖。RAM/EOS市场使用Bancor流动性算法定价。市场收取0.5%的费用。账户方面,EOS账户有两种不同类型的密钥,此外,所有者密钥可以设置具有自定义权限的活动密钥。

       Antelope IBC是EOS首批举措之一,它实施了基于轻客户端的区块链间通信协议。这允许基于Antelope的区块链安全地相互通信并横向扩展。代币经济学方面,EOS代币用于安全性(验证者和委托者质押)和资源分配(CPU、NET和RAM费用)。初始分配包括公开代币销售(%)、团队和创始人(%)等。通货膨胀率目前为3%,其中三分之一分配给区块生产者,三分之二分配给ENF。

       网络活动方面,用户数量和交易量有所波动。验证人和委托人数量也在变化。生态系统方面,EOS包括DeFi应用程序、NFT市场和项目、mokoid 源码游戏应用等。DeFi TVL在过去一年下降,但仍活跃。最受欢迎的dapp是Upland,一款Play-to-Earn数字房地产和元宇宙游戏。NFT和游戏方面,AtomicHub是主要的NFT市场。赠款计划包括Pomelo、ENF直接赠款框架和EOS网络风险投资公司(ENV)。

       路线图和技术改进方面,ENF计划发布新的白皮书,详细说明技术升级计划,包括引入即时终结的新共识机制和EVM解决方案。ENF与联盟其他成员一起努力改革Antelope共识机制,并计划实施基于BFT协议的即时确定性升级。此外,ENF正在资助和开发EOS EVM解决方案,计划在年4月日主网上启动。增长战略方面,ENF将继续推动网络的增长,通过资助系统和生态系统基金来支持。

       EOS的重建和改进计划旨在提升技术堆栈和生态系统,吸引新用户和开发者。虽然网络活动指标有所改善,但仍需努力与顶级智能合约平台竞争。技术升级和新战略的实施,以及ENF的持续支持,为EOS的复兴奠定了基础。如果这些升级成功并获得采用,EOS可能将再次成为行业关注的焦点。

EOS超级节点竞选到底是什么?有什么用?

       EOS采用的是DPOS(中文名称为委托权益证明)共识机制,它是通过被社区选举的可信帐户(受托人,得票数排行前位)来创建区块,它的特点就是出块时间比较短,而且效率比较高,几乎不会分叉。节点是构建EOS网络的基础,上面所说的个可信账户即为EOS超级节点(同时有个备用节点),由它们产生EOS网络的所有区块记录。之所以EOS要竞选超级节点,就是通过DPOS共识机制决定的。现在几个节点就在为主网上线付出自己的努力,后期他们还要负责出块,运维等工作。

必看ETH低风险套利的一种方法

       话不多说,直接上干货。

       近一段关注EOS众筹比较多,看到有小伙伴根据EOS/ETH的数据,发了如下一张图:

       图中明显可以看出涨跌周期基本以小时为一个轮回,如果在每间隔小时高卖低买一次,算是一种比较稳妥的获利办法。

       你一定很好奇,这真的是一个规律吗?或者说为什么是这样呢?

       这还要从EOS众筹开始说起。BM当时天才的提出了EOS众筹的想法,以小时为周期,coloros源码持续一年,此种众筹方式可谓前无古人。

       我猜测BM是不是考虑区块链乃是全球共同关注的项目,因此把众筹时间固定在几点似乎都不合适,那干脆轮流,每个时间都轮到。

       现在把ETH换成EOS有两种方式,一是在二级市场买入,二是参与一级市场的众筹。

       假设一级市场众筹的价格持续高于二级市场买入,那么参与众筹的人必然越来越少,让参与一级市场众筹的价格慢慢降低。降低到什么程度呢?比较合理的结果是:一级市场众筹的价格略低于或等于二级市场的价格。

       举一个例子就明白了,以下数据仅为说明用。

       比如在二级市场(就是在交易所买入)1个ETH可以换个EOS,但是在一级市场(参与众筹)1个ETH可以换个EOS,那必然有人会用1个ETH参与众筹换来个EOS,然后在二级市场换回ETH,这样在不考虑手续费的情况下,1个ETH就变成了个ETH,获利了%。

       近期随着EOS价格的走高,每天参与众筹的ETH多达4万多个。

       这里肯定有不少比例的资金是在进行一级市场和二级市场的搬砖套利。

       如果知道了这个原理,那么可以分析出在EOS的众筹时间点就是一个EOS价格的相对低点,这时用ETH换成EOS,等过一小段时间等EOS涨上去,再把EOS换回ETH,实现套利。

       以最近两周多的数据来分析,假设在每天众筹的时间点把ETH换成EOS,在一小时后把EOS换回ETH,可以盈利多少呢?

       经过计算,最近天的收益总计为%,看起来不算多,好处是风险较小。

       如果资金量较大收益绝对收益也比较可观。

       即使发生风险,EOS和ETH也都是大币种,也不会砸在手里。

       由于时间仓促,我后续会更新上述表格,补充EOS众筹当时的价格和众筹1小时后的价格。

       最后小结一下操作步骤:

       ①在EOS的众筹网站查询每天EOS的众筹时间

       ②在众筹时间点,在交易网站(如币安)用ETH买入EOS

       ③1小时后再把EOS换回ETH

       这是一种低风险套利的方式,但并不代表没有风险。有时二级市场的波动比较大,出现暂时的亏损也是正常的。

       如在图中可以看到,在4月日,市场波动极大,在众筹后的一个小时内EOS/ETH下跌了%。

       不过我们做事情,hdparm源码只要做概率大的事情即可。如果像银行存款那样,虽然几乎无风险,但年化收益率只有区区%。

       如果用理性战胜人损失厌恶的感性,那么人的能力边界无疑就扩大了一些。

       这也是借鉴了量化交易的思路,如果确认一件事情是大概率获利,那就学习冷冰冰的计算机,毫无感情的执行即可。

       这里有一点需要说明:现在距离EOS主网上线还有最后一个月,所以这种低风险套利的办法只能再持续4周,有兴趣尝试的小伙伴可要抓紧了。

ETH的挖矿原理与机制

       待字闺中开发了一门区块链方面的课程:《深入浅出ETH原理与智能合约开发》,马良老师讲授。此文集记录我的学习笔记。

       课程共8节课。其中,前四课讲ETH原理,后四课讲智能合约。

       第四课分为三部分:

       这篇文章是第四课第一部分的学习笔记:Ethash算法。

       这节课介绍的是以太坊非常核心的挖矿算法。

       在介绍Ethash算法之前,先讲一些背景知识。其实区块链技术主要是解决一个共识的问题,而共识是一个层次很丰富的概念,这里把范畴缩小,只讨论区块链中的共识。

       什么是共识?

       在区块链中,共识是指哪个节点有记账权。网络中有多个节点,理论上都有记账权,首先面临的问题就是,到底谁来记帐。另一个问题,交易一定是有顺序的,即谁在前,前在后。这样可以解决双花问题。区块链中的共识机制就是解决这两个问题,谁记帐和交易的顺序。

       什么是工作量证明算法

       为了决定众多节点中谁来记帐,可以有多种方案。其中,工作量证明就让节点去算一个哈希值,满足难度目标值的胜出。这个过程只能通过枚举计算,谁算的快,谁获胜的概率大。收益跟节点的工作量有关,这就是工作量证明算法。

       为什么要引入工作量证明算法?

       Hash Cash 由Adam Back 在年发表,中本聪首次在比特币中应用来解决共识问题。

       它最初用来解决垃圾邮件问题。

       其主要设计思想是通过暴力搜索,找到一种Block头部组合(通过调整nonce)使得嵌套的SHA单向散列值输出小于一个特定的值(Target)。

       这个算法是计算密集型算法,一开始从CPU挖矿,转而为GPU,转而为FPGA,转而为ASIC,从而使得算力变得非常集中。

       算力集中就会带来一个问题,若有一个矿池的算力达到%,则它就会有作恶的风险。这是比特币等使用工作量证明算法的系统的弊端。而以太坊则吸取了这个教训,进行了一些改进,诞生了Ethash算法。

       Ethash算法吸取了比特币的教训,专门设计了非常不利用计算的模型,它采用了I/O密集的模型,I/O慢,计算再快也没用。这样,对专用集成电路则不是那么有效。

       该算法对GPU友好。一是考虑如果只支持CPU,担心易被木马攻击;二是现在的显存都很大。

       轻型客户端的算法不适于挖矿,易于验证;快速启动

       算法中,主要依赖于Keccake 。

       数据源除了传统的Block头部,还引入了随机数阵列DAG(有向非循环图)(Vitalik提出)

         

       种子值很小。根据种子值生成缓存值,缓存层的初始值为M,每个世代增加K。

       在缓存层之下是矿工使用的数据值,数据层的初始值是1G,每个世代增加8M。整个数据层的大小是Bytes的素数倍。

         

       框架主要分为两个部分,一是DAG的生成,二是用Hashimoto来计算最终的结果。

       DAG分为三个层次,种子层,缓存层,数据层。三个层次是逐渐增大的。

       种子层很小,依赖上个世代的种子层。

       缓存层的第一个数据是根据种子层生成的,后面的根据前面的一个来生成,它是一个串行化的过程。其初始大小是M,每个世代增加K。每个元素字节。

       数据层就是要用到的数据,其初始大小1G,现在约2个G,每个元素字节。数据层的元素依赖缓存层的个元素。

       整个流程是内存密集型。

       首先是头部信息和随机数结合在一起,做一个Keccak运算,获得初始的单向散列值Mix[0],字节。然后,通过另外一个函数,映射到DAG上,获取一个值,再与Mix[0]混合得到Mix[1],如此循环次,得到Mix[],字节。

       接下来经过后处理过程,得到 mix final 值,字节。(这个值在前面两个小节《 :GHOST协议 》、《 :搭建测试网络 》都出现过)

       再经过计算,得出结果。把它和目标值相比较,小于则挖矿成功。

       难度值大,目标值小,就越难(前面需要的 0 越多)。

       这个过程也是挖矿难,验证容易。

       为防止矿机,mix function函数也有更新过。

         

       难度公式见课件截图。

       根据上一个区块的难度,来推算下一个。

       从公式看出,难度由三部分组成,首先是上一区块的难度,然后是线性部分,最后是非线性部分。

       非线性部分也叫难度炸弹,在过了一个特定的时间节点后,难度是指数上升。如此设计,其背后的目的是,在以太坊的项目周期中,在大都会版本后的下一个版本中,要转换共识,由POW变为POW、POS混合型的协议。基金会的意思可能是使得挖矿变得没意思。

       难度曲线图显示,年月,难度有一个大的下降,奖励也由5个变为3个。

       本节主要介绍了Ethash算法,不足之处,请批评指正。

国内eth十大矿池排名

       以太坊的挖矿过程与比特币的几乎是一样的。ETH通过挖矿产生,平均每秒产生1个块,挖矿的时候,矿工使用计算机去计算一道函数计算题的答案,直到有矿工计算到正确答案即完成区块的打包信息,而作为第一个计算出来的矿工将会得到3枚ETH的奖励。

       如果矿工A率先算出正确的答案,那么矿工A将获得以太币作为奖励,并在全网广播告诉所有矿工“我已经把答案算出来了”并让所有在答题的矿工们进行验证并更新正确答案。如果矿工B算出正确答案,那么其他矿工将会停止当前的解题过程,记录正确答案,并开始做下一道题,直到算出正确答案,并一直重复此过程。

       矿工在这个游戏中很难作弊。他们是没法伪装工作又得出正确答案。这就是为什么这个解题的过程被称为“工作量证明”(POW)。

       解题的过程大约每-秒,矿工就会挖出一个区块。如果矿工挖矿的速度过快或者过慢,算法会自动调整题目的难度,把出块速度保持在秒左右。

       矿工获取这些ETH币是有随机性的,挖矿的收益取决于投入的算力,就相当你的计算机越多,你答题的正确的概率也就越高,更容易获得区块奖励。

       1、 以太坊

       它是全球领先的比特币数据服务提供商和矿池和钱包解决方案提供商。从年开始,团队从区块浏览器等行业基础设施入手,致力于构建各个子领域的新标准。品牌可以在钱包、矿池、行情、资讯等领域看到。

       2、F2Pool

       F2Pool 是中国最大的比特币和莱特币挖矿系统矿池之一。数据显示,鱼池目前是全球第二大矿池,仅次于蚂蚁矿池。

       3、钱印

       碧音成立于年月,由原核心团队打造。团队的产品和技术输出现在服务于全网大部分比特币算力;两年内打造了多个产品,跨越区块链浏览器、矿池、钱包等多个垂直领域。碧音矿池是一个专业的矿池,支持所有主流币种的挖矿。目前支持的币种包括:BTC、BCH、BSV、ZEC、LTC、ETH、DCR、DASH、XMR。

       4、火币矿池

       火币矿池是全球首个集数字资产挖掘与交易于一体的矿池平台。它采用基于POW挖矿机制的全新分配模型FPPS。市场上大部分矿池采用传统的PPS结算和分配模式。相比之下,火币的FPPS模式降低了矿工的打包费,每个矿工可以增加5%左右的利润。火币矿池通过这一举措,将其与其他矿池区分开来,吸引矿工入驻。

       5、蚂蚁矿池

       蚂蚁矿池是BitTaiwan利用大量资源开发的高效数字货币矿池。致力于为矿工提供更友好的界面、更完善的功能、更多的使用方面、更丰厚透明的收益。货币的发展做出更多贡献。蚂蚁矿池是一个高效的数字货币矿池,致力于为矿工提供更友好的界面、更好的功能、更便捷的使用和更丰厚透明的收益。蚂蚁矿池为多种数字货币提供比特币、莱特币、以太坊挖矿服务,支持PPS、PPLNS、SOLO等多种支付方式。

       6、微比特

       微比特是一家专业的数字货币技术服务商。其服务范围包括数字货币交易平台、数字货币矿池、云挖矿合约。成立于年5月,同年6月上线比特币矿池,月上线云挖矿产品。 年3月,微比特获得由BitTaiwan领投的万元A轮融资,以拓展交易所业务。 6月,微比特即将上线数字货币交易平台。

       7、COIN第二类是其他矿池,如以太坊矿池、Spark矿池;第三类是交易所矿池,如火币矿池、OK矿池、币安矿池。币安作为新世界的“数字经济操作系统”,在数字资产交易流通领域,在区块链市场教育领域,在去中心化流通探索领域,资产流通平台在云计算领域,在市场和数字资产大数据领域,在金融衍生品领域,等生态系统,都取得了很好的成绩,也创造了全球影响力。当然,对于区块链和数字经济领域的实体经济,“云算力平台”,即矿池,币安也在极短的时间内创造了另一种“商业内涵”。

       9、OKEXPool

       在公布的数据中,OKExPool从年月的市场份额约0%迅速发展为市场份额第六大的矿池。但是,在算力趋势曲线上,OKExPool在年1月算力出现大幅下滑。有市场人士对PANews表示,推测OKExPool算力快速下滑的原因可能是加入了更加中心化的小矿场,目前还缺乏投资者加入算力结构。

       虽然交易所普遍是矿池领域的新人,但交易所持有的矿池业务相对于传统公司仍有一定的天然优势。

       、BTCTOP

       Lybit矿池经过多年的稳定运行,最初是一个全网算力最大的私有矿池。现面向市场以太币,诚邀所有矿工分享其技术带来的挖矿收益。全新升级改版的乐比特矿池系统更加贴合客户需求,内容更丰富,操作更简单。

eos和以太坊的区别

两者共识机制不同。

       EOS和以太坊之间的另一个显著区别是区块链共识机制,以太坊使用的是工作量证明机制(类似按劳分配),而EOS将使用DPOS授权股权证明机制,类似于董事会,董事会成员数量有限,由大家选举产生,被选中的董事会成员可以行使权利。

什么是POW、POS、DPOS、POR

       都是区块链的底层共识算法,POW费电。EOS用的DPOS,个超级节点,但是老贿选,所以现在DPOS基本上被扣上了中心化区块链的帽子,我也觉得这样违背区块链精神。POR共识协议是最新由贝克链提出的一种共识机制,由公钥之父、图灵奖得主Whitfield Diffie的Cryptic Labs孵化,这个实验室是世界上最牛的网络安全实验室。

copyright © 2016 powered by 皮皮网   sitemap